[Bug 1267798] [NEW] Init script returns exit 0 for status when default has START=no

2014-01-10 Thread Greg Sutcliffe
Public bug reported:

Currently, if one sets START=no in /etc/default/puppetmaster, the init
script will exit with exit-code 0, regardless of whether the service is
running or not. In the case where you have a puppet manifest like:

service { 'puppetmaster': ensure = stopped }

Puppet will try to stop the service on every agent run, because status
is returning zero, so Puppet thinks it is running.

This issue was fixed upstream in this commit:

https://github.com/puppetlabs/puppet/commit/e48902a7d881e84861d366af5ff88fc0146037da

As it's a one-liner, could this be backported into the Ubuntu packages?

[Bug 1267957] [NEW] Bug with Xen and Nvidia Optimus cards

2014-01-10 Thread HighBomber
Public bug reported:

The following error occurs when starting Xen with Nvidia Optimus
graphics cards:

ERROR (SrvDaemon:349) Exception starting xend (Looped capability chain: 
:01:00.0)
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File /usr/lib/xen-4.3/bin/../lib/python/xen/xend/server/SrvDaemon.py, line 
341, in run
servers = SrvServer.create()
  File /usr/lib/xen-4.3/bin/../lib/python/xen/xend/server/SrvServer.py, line 
258, in create
root.putChild('xend', SrvRoot())
  File /usr/lib/xen-4.3/bin/../lib/python/xen/xend/server/SrvRoot.py, line 
40, in __init__
self.get(name)
  File /usr/lib/xen-4.3/bin/../lib/python/xen/web/SrvDir.py, line 84, in get
val = val.getobj()
  File /usr/lib/xen-4.3/bin/../lib/python/xen/web/SrvDir.py, line 52, in 
getobj
self.obj = klassobj()
  File /usr/lib/xen-4.3/bin/../lib/python/xen/xend/server/SrvNode.py, line 
30, in __init__
self.xn = XendNode.instance()
  File /usr/lib/xen-4.3/bin/../lib/python/xen/xend/XendNode.py, line 1181, in 
instance
inst = XendNode()
  File /usr/lib/xen-4.3/bin/../lib/python/xen/xend/XendNode.py, line 159, in 
__init__
self._init_PPCIs()
  File /usr/lib/xen-4.3/bin/../lib/python/xen/xend/XendNode.py, line 282, in 
_init_PPCIs
for pci_dev in PciUtil.get_all_pci_devices():
  File /usr/lib/xen-4.3/bin/../lib/python/xen/util/pci.py, line 474, in 
get_all_pci_devices
return map(PciDevice, get_all_pci_dict())
  File /usr/lib/xen-4.3/bin/../lib/python/xen/util/pci.py, line 699, in 
__init__
self.get_info_from_sysfs()
  File /usr/lib/xen-4.3/bin/../lib/python/xen/util/pci.py, line 1269, in 
get_info_from_sysfs
self.find_capability(0x11)
  File /usr/lib/xen-4.3/bin/../lib/python/xen/util/pci.py, line 1236, in 
find_capability
('Looped capability chain: %s' % self.name))
PciDeviceParseError: Looped capability chain: :01:00.0
[2014-01-10 12:53:46 4486] INFO (SrvDaemon:220) Xend exited with status 1.

The following patch fixes the bug.

--- /root/pci.py 2012-03-31 16:36:52.633262092 +0100
+++ /usr/lib/xen-4.1/lib/python/xen/util/pci.py 2012-03-31 16:41:00.057262001 
+0100
@@ -1266,7 +1266,12 @@
pass
def get_info_from_sysfs(self):
- self.find_capability(0x11)
+ try:
+ self.find_capability(0x11)
+ except PciDeviceParseError, err:
+ log.error(Caught '%s' % err)
+ return False
+
sysfs_mnt = find_sysfs_mnt()
if sysfs_mnt == None:
return False

Details and the patch here (I am not the author):
http://martin.schinz.de/blog/2012/03/31/fixing-xen-daemon-on-a-laptop-with-nvidia-optimus-graphics/

[Bug 1266840] Re: maas-dns failed to install completely on Trusty

2014-01-10 Thread Jeff Lane
https://bugs.launchpad.net/maas/+bug/1035998/comments/2

Reading that comment, it suggests that the named.conf.maas file should
be empty by design so I created one like so:

sudo touch /etc/named/maas/named.conf.maas

and restarted bind and apache.

Then, I deleted my node and retried and it successfully commissioned and
declared.

From there, I was able to access it via the UI and click Commission
Node and the node turned on and successfully booted the commissioning
image. (It was failing before because DNS was never started, causing the
commissioning image to hang)

[Bug 1268050] [NEW] Deprovision breaks iDNS registration when using cloud-init

2014-01-10 Thread Launchpad Bug Tracker
You have been subscribed to a public bug:

Hello,

This is a request to please backport this patch from the 1.4.1 agent:
https://github.com/WindowsAzure/WALinuxAgent/commit/375f1ede38fd323c2560e7e21ba99ac50bc66acd


Summary
The Ubuntu images in the Windows Azure gallery (except for 12.10) all use 
cloud-init for provisioning.  This means that WALA provisioning and the 
hostname monitor are disabled via /etc/waagent.conf.

However, when a user runs 'waagent -deprovision' the agent will attempt
to modify the 'send host-name' parameter dhclient.conf file to set the
hostname to localhost.localdomain.  But with provisioning and the
monitor disabled, the agent does not have a chance to reset this
parameter to the proper hostname.  So captured Ubuntu images will not
register their correct DNS name with the DHCP server.

In the Ubuntu images this behavior is not necessary since dhclient is
already configured to send its hostname to the DHCP server.  This patch
makes the agent a bit smarter about this and leaves dhclient.conf alone
if it sees that it is already configured to send it's current hostname
to the DHCP server.
